There are serious health fears for Red Bull owner Dietrich Mateschitz.

Rumors have been circulating for some time that the 78-year-old, the world’s richest Austrian who keeps his life very private, is suffering from a serious illness.

« He is not feeling right, » reports Roger Benoit, F1 correspondent for Swiss newspaper Blick.

A journalist from the major Austrian newspaper Kronen Zeitung also admits that there is « great concerns about the health of Mateschitz, who has not been seen publicly in months.

« Insiders report that he hasn’t even been available to his closest employees lately. »

A spokesperson for the energy drink company founded by Mateschitz said: « As you know, it has always been important to Mr. Mateschitz to keep his private life out of public view. That has not changed. »

Dr Helmut Marko, who is Mateschitz’s closest contact in the world of Formula 1 – where Red Bull owns two teams – also declined to comment.

« No comment, this is a private matter. We do not comment on it. »
